You are making/taking a call
Press Foxmenu > Foxkey Enquiry.
Enter the phone number of the enquiry call party.
Enquiry call party is called; first call partner is on hold.
Note:
You can also search in the phone book, last-number redial list or call list
for the phone number of the person you are looking for.
Connecting with notification:
Wait until the person has answered the call. Announce the call party.
Put the handset on-hook or press the
Your first call partner and the other person are now connected with
each other.
Note:
If the other user does not answer, you can cancel the enquiry call with
Foxmenu > Foxkey
Connecting without notification:
Wait for the first ringing tone, then hang up.
The other party is then called directly by your first call partner.
Note:
Recall: If the other party does not answer, the call comes back to your
phone.
